I stayed at the Sheraton several years ago and would never do it again! It is not close to the city and the last shuttle bus was at 6:00pm. You were locked into eating dinner in their dining room. If you stay in town to eat dinner you would have to take a local bus back and they would drop you off on the freeway so you would have to walk a good distance back to the hotel. And you know about those crazy Italian drivers! Check with the hotel regarding their shuttle. Also, they only take a certain amount of people and if there were too many, the taxi was your only option. Florence is wonderful though. Enjoy!
